Daniela Hantuchová (born April 23, 1983) is a Slovak professional tennis player. She turned professional in 1999 and had her
breakthrough year in 2002, when she won her first Tier I tournament and ended the year in the top ten. She is currently coached
by Larri Passos. Her WTA Tour mentor in the "Partners for Success" program was Martina Navrátilová, who was her doubles partner
for a brief period in early 2005. As of February 22, 2010, Hantuchová is ranked World No. 24 in singles.
